New Concepts of Artistry in Rhythm

Album by Stan Kenton

New Concepts of Artistry in Rhythm is a studio album by American jazz bandleader Stan Kenton, released in 1953. It combines progressive big-band arrangements, extended harmonies, dense brass voicings and orchestral colour drawn from modern classical techniques, and it comes during Kenton's shift toward more arranged and experimental textures in his post-war work.
